Ivory Coast has celebrated the return of a sacred talking drum that was looted by French colonial forces 110 years ago. The ceremonial artifact was welcomed back to its home village during the celebrations.
The repatriation marks a significant cultural moment for the West African nation, as the historic instrument is finally restored to its place of origin after more than a century abroad.
